New Zealand Cable Tray Installation and Construction

Cable tray installation in New Zealand involves careful planning, compliance with AS/NZS 3000 standards, proper material selection, precise mounting, and thorough inspection to ensure safety and maintainability.

Planning and Design

Before installation, plan the cable tray route based on the site layout, electrical design, and load requirements. Consider clearance, cable separation, and future expansion. Review approved shop drawings to confirm tray layout, length, and location in electrical rooms, plant rooms, or service corridors . Obtain client approval for designs, materials, and drawings before starting work .

Material Selection and Preparation

Choose the appropriate tray type: ladder trays for airflow and heavy loads, perforated trays for lighter loads, or solid-bottom trays for protection . Inspect all materials for damage or discrepancies and store trays horizontally on flat surfaces with timber supports to prevent moisture or sunlight damage . Ensure all tools and equipment comply with contract requirements.

Installation Steps

  1. Site Preparation: Inspect the workspace, install safety barriers, and coordinate with other trades to avoid interference .
  2. Marking and Support Points: Use chalk lines or laser levels to mark the tray path and support locations, typically spaced 1.5–3 meters apart depending on tray type and load .
  3. Mounting Trays: Secure trays using brackets, wall arms, or ceiling struts. Align trays straight and level, using connectors and fittings for long runs .
  4. Cable Laying: Organize cables neatly with ties or straps, separating by voltage and function. Leave slack for expansion or future adjustments .
  5. Grounding and Bonding: Metal trays must be properly grounded and bonded to maintain electrical safety and compliance with AS/NZS 3000 .
  6. Labeling and Documentation: Clearly label each cable and maintain updated wiring maps for troubleshooting and audits .

Compliance and Inspection

All installations must comply with AS/NZS 3000:2018 and its amendments, covering earthing, bonding, RCD protection, and wiring methods . Conduct visual and dimensional inspections to ensure trays, conduits, accessories, and grounding connections meet approved designs and standards . Perform final checks for loose clamps, misalignment, or overfilled sections.

Maintenance

Routine inspections are essential to check for corrosion, loose wires, or broken clamps. Preventive maintenance extends tray lifespan and ensures system reliability . By following these steps, New Zealand cable tray installations achieve safety, scalability, and ease of maintenance, while adhering to local electrical regulations and industry best practices.
